What to Eat

New Orleans is known for its delicious food. Some of the most popular dishes include: * Gumbo: A thick soup made with okra, tomatoes, and meat. * Jambalaya: A rice dish made with shrimp, chicken, and sausage. * Po'boys: A sandwich made with fried seafood or meat. * Beignets: A square of fried dough covered in powdered sugar.

Where to Go

There are many things to see and do in New Orleans. Some of the most popular attractions include: * French Quarter: The historic heart of New Orleans, with its charming streets, shops, and restaurants. * Jackson Square: A public square in the French Quarter, home to the St. Louis Cathedral and the Cabildo. * Garden District: A historic neighborhood known for its beautiful antebellum mansions. * Audubon Park: A large park with a zoo, a golf course, and a botanical garden.
